Age estimation by pulp/tooth ratio in canines by mesial and vestibular peri-apical X-rays
Roberto Cameriere1, Luigi Ferrante, Maria Giovanna Belcastro
1Institute of Legal Medicine, University of Macerata, Via Don Minzoni 9, 62100 Macerata, Italy. r.cameriere@unimc.it
Abstract:
Changes in the size of the pulp canal, caused by apposition of secondary dentine, are the best morphometric parameters for estimating age by X-rays. The apposition of secondary dentine is the most frequently used method for age estimation in adult subjects. In two previous papers, we studied the application of the pulp/tooth area ratio by peri-apical X-rays as an indicator of age at death. The aim of the present study was to test the accuracy of age evaluation by combined analysis of labio-lingual and mesial peri-apical X-rays of lower and upper canines. A total of 200 such X-rays were assembled from 57 male and 43 female skeletons of Caucasian origin, aged between 20 and 79 years. For each skeleton, dental maturity was evaluated by measuring the pulp/tooth area ratio according to labio-lingual and mesial X-rays on upper (x(1), x(2)) and lower (x(3), x(4)) canines. Very good agreement was found between intra-observer measurements. Statistical analysis showed that all variables x(1), x(2), x(3), and x(4) and the first-order interaction between x(1) and x(3) contributed significantly to the fit, so that they were included in the regression model, yielding the following regression formula: Age = 120.737 - 337.112x(1) - 79.709x(2) - 364.534x(3) - 65.655x(4) + 1531.918x(1)x(3) . The residual standard error of estimated ages was 3.62 years, with 94 degrees of freedom, and the median of the residuals was -0.155 years, with an interquartile range of 4.96 years. The accuracy of the method was ME = 2.8 years, where ME is the mean prediction error. The model also explained 94% of total variance (R(2) = 0.94).

Tooth Anatomy
The Crown, Neck, and Root
The visible part of the tooth is referred to as the crown. It's covered by enamel, the hardest substance in the human body. The crown is uniquely shaped for each type of tooth, allowing for different functions such as cutting, tearing, or grinding food.
